/en/
en
true
1471
750
20045
144
195
Lima
1577
37563
lima
173
Lima
168
-12.046373
50
-77.042754
13
false
1,3,5,8
1686
13610
1567
624
9239
2
1020
18500
S/
955756
Map
Street ViewExplore
AddressAv. Izaguirre